Florida House backs plan to use phosphogypsum in road construction
Phosphogypsum stack in West-Central Florida. By Seán Kinane/WMNF News (2010). The House on Wednesday passed a bill that would clear the way for demonstration projects about using phosphogypsum, a byproduct of the phosphate industry, in building roads.. House members voted 81-25 to approve the bill (HB 1191), sponsored by Rep. Lawrence …

Properties, Purification, and Applications of Phosphogypsum…
Phosphogypsum (PG) is a by-product produced during the wet process of phosphoric acid (H3PO4) production from natural phosphate rocks. Approximately 4–6 tons of PG is produced per ton of phosphoric acid production, where worldwide PG generation exceeds 300 million tons annually. Notice of Pending Approval for Other Use of Phosphogypsum…
Any other use of phosphogypsum requires prior approval from the EPA. The EPA may approve a request for a specific use of phosphogypsum if it determines that the proposed use is at least as protective of public health as placement of phosphogypsum in a stack. The processes for requesting such an approval are described in 40 CFR 61.206.
